Output a31537361c84e14dea7f22d6c3e84aa2a6d48d58e9dd0494fbb1961325087583:0

value
6982803491576
script pubkey
OP_0 OP_PUSHBYTES_20 bb19959125f5ddf3b749bb0ff4fd5d8dc8055ca4
address
tb1qhvvetyf97hwl8d6fhv8lfl2a3hyq2h9ywcke53
transaction
a31537361c84e14dea7f22d6c3e84aa2a6d48d58e9dd0494fbb1961325087583
confirmations
189086
spent
true